SF-IV MIS Cannulated Bone Cement Spinal Pedicle Screw 5.5mm System

🛡️
Minimally Invasive Access: Smart design for minimum invasive access of implants, reducing patient trauma.
🎯
Precision Mechanism: Long sleeve protection mechanism ensures accurate pedicle screw introducing.
⚙️
Versatile Rods: Both straight and pre-bend rods are available with smart introducing methods.
🔧
Advanced Instrumentation: Easier and stronger compression/extraction achieved by smart surgical instruments.

Specifications
Product Name Diameter & Length (mm) Material
SF-IV MIS Cannulated Bone Cement Multiaxial Pedicle Screw φ4.5 x (30-55mm) Titanium Alloy
φ5.0 x (30-55mm)Titanium Alloy
φ5.5 x (30-55mm)Titanium Alloy
φ6.0 x (30-55mm)Titanium Alloy
φ6.5 x (30-55mm)Titanium Alloy
φ7.0 x (30-55mm)Titanium Alloy
